Factors Affecting the Cost
Not all calls cost the same. Prices vary based on tyre type, location, and damage. A simple tread puncture? Usually £35–£50. Full replacement for a standard tyre? £70–£150 per tyre, depending on brand and size. Night-time or weekend call-outs can add a small premium.

Tips to Avoid Hidden Costs
Ask about call-out fees, check if balancing and disposal are included, and confirm tyre options upfront. A transparent mobile service ensures there are no surprises.
